OVERVIEW

 

Consent is at the heart of all interactions with patients/clients requiring healthcare. The delivery of healthcare is complex requiring many Healthcare professionals to interact & engage with the patient. The process of obtaining consent is not as straightforward as it might seem given recent judicial decisions (Montgomery v Lanarkshire Health Board 2015) & (Amendments to the Mental Capacity Act 2005).

This one-day course equips you to fully understand your role in the consenting process and matters that you need to take into consideration in order for the consent to be valid.

The course is of interest to all Healthcare Professionals, Healthcare Support Workers and any other providers of healthcare.

CONTENT

 

Brief introduction of the English Legal system

When is consent necessary

How much information must the patient be given

Recording consent

Assessment of competency

Treatment that can be given in patients best interests

Advance decisions

The whole day is supported with case studies and delegate participation

AIMS AND OUTCOMES

 

At the end of this session you will

  • understand the reasons for obtaining consent
  • understand the process of obtaining consent
  • understand the importance of providing adequate information
  • understand the concept of capacity
  • understand in what circumstances treatment can be provided in the patient's best interests
